Tieto announces personnel negotiations to ensure competitiveness in the market


Tieto Corporation STOCK EXCHANGE RELEASE 9 June 2014, 9.00 am EET

To improve its competitiveness and drive the renewal of services and competences, Tieto plans to reduce a total of 230 positions. The reductions will affect the Consulting and System Integration (CSI) service line and Product Development Services. Of the positions, up to 180 are in Finland. The negotiations are part of the anticipated restructuring measures communicated in the first-quarter interim report.

The IT services industry change drives competence renewal in Consulting and System Integration

To increase its competitiveness in application services through improved efficiency, Tieto’s Consulting and System Integration service line plans to reduce a total of 160 positions, of which 110 are in Finland and 50 are in Sweden and other countries.

 “The demand in the market is shifting from traditional services to modern technology, industrialized services and cloud, requiring a competence shift to address new growth,” says Satu Kiiskinen, Executive Vice President, Consulting and System Integration. “The results for CSI developed positively the first quarter, with several growing areas. However, to ensure our competitiveness in the market, we still need to improve the efficiency in our application services business through continuing Global Delivery and modernization,” Kiiskinen concludes.

High volatility in the demand for Product Development Services continues

Product Development Services has identified the need to increase the restructuring communicated earlier. According to initial estimates, the personnel impact is 70 positions in Finland.

“The market situation continues to be challenging in Finland, mainly driven by increased insourcing of product development. These changes in the project base require additional restructuring of the organization and hence the need for additional headcount reductions,” says Antti Vasara, Executive Vice President, Product Development Services.

As communicated earlier, Tieto anticipates that its restructuring costs will amount to around half of the 2013 level. In 2014 overall, Tieto’s restructuring needs will be based on potential overcapacity in selected businesses, automation and the need to align the company’s competence base with the market demand.

Tieto is the largest Nordic IT services company providing full life-cycle services for both the private and public sectors and product development services in the field of communications and embedded technologies. The company has global presence through its product development business and global delivery centres. Tieto is committed to developing enterprises and society through IT by realizing new opportunities in customers’ business transformation. At Tieto, we believe in professional development and results.

Founded 1968, headquartered in Helsinki, Finland and with approximately 14 000 experts, the company operates in over 20 countries with net sales of approximately EUR 1.6 billion. Tieto’s shares are listed on NASDAQ OMX in Helsinki and Stockholm. Please visit www.tieto.com for more information.
